Jo’burg theatre pick: May 6 2011

Wits University’s Wale festival (Wits Arts and Literature Experience), now in its fourth year, has an exciting line-up that includes a literary component, visual arts and theatre.

One of the festival’s highlights is Smoke and Mirrors, a new piece of physical theatre by renowned choreographer and performer Athena Mazarakis, working with the Forgotten Angle Theatre Collaborative. The piece is described by Mazarakis as invoking today’s society. ‘We live our lives negotiating an endless series of smoke and mirrors: in societies administered by political subterfuge,” she says. The work questions what really lies beneath human interaction and how fine the line is that separates illusion from reality. It also asks how complicit human beings are in the ‘deception” that takes place.
